After more than 200 hours of intensive hands-on testing, fishing experts have identified the standout walleye rods for the 2026 season, with models ranging from budget-friendly options under $40 to premium rods approaching $300.

The comprehensive evaluation process examined rods across multiple walleye fishing techniques, focusing on real-world performance and the critical ability to detect subtle bites that often determine success on the water. The testing revealed significant evolution in the walleye rod market, as manufacturers have increasingly developed specialized actions and power ratings tailored specifically for walleye fishing scenarios.

"It's remarkable how the right rod can influence your catch rate. These new models have changed the game for both new and seasoned anglers," said Mason Reed, an avid fisherman and reviewer who conducted extensive testing across diverse fishing scenarios, from vertical jigging in deeper waters to trolling crankbaits near weed edges.

The St. Croix Avid Series emerged as the top overall choice, earning editor's choice recognition for its exceptional combination of design and performance. The rod features premium cork construction, fast action response, and robust SCIII+ Carbon construction that delivers both durability and sensitivity. Perhaps most impressive is the manufacturer's confidence in the product, backed by an industry-leading 15-year warranty.

"The Avid Series really delivers on sensitivity, which is crucial when fishing for walleye," Reed stated, emphasizing how the rod's responsiveness translates directly to improved fishing success. The enhanced sensitivity allows anglers to feel the lightest nibbles that characterize walleye feeding behavior, often making the difference between a successful outing and going home empty-handed.

For budget-conscious anglers, the KastKing Spartacus II claimed the best value designation with its impressive performance-to-price ratio. Priced at $54.99, this rod challenges the notion that quality equipment requires a substantial investment. The Spartacus II includes an extra tip section for versatility and incorporates high-quality IM6 graphite construction, providing the flexibility and responsiveness serious walleye anglers demand without the premium price tag.

"For those who might be entering the sport or just want something reliable at a great price, the Spartacus II is a game-changer," Reed noted, highlighting how the rod opens quality walleye fishing to a broader audience of anglers.

The Ugly Stik GX2 maintains its position as the most popular choice among walleye enthusiasts, continuing its reputation for legendary toughness at an accessible $39.97 price point. With over 6,000 customer reviews praising its consistency and durability, the GX2 has earned its place as a reliable workhorse backed by a solid 7-year warranty.

"This rod is a favorite not just for its pricing, but for its ability to withstand the rigors of walleye fishing," Reed remarked, explaining why the model continues to dominate sales despite increased competition from newer designs.

The testing process evaluated twelve different walleye rod models, revealing the breadth of options available to modern anglers. At the premium end, the St. Croix Legend, featuring advanced SCIV+ Carbon construction and priced at $285.00, demonstrated tournament-grade performance that justifies its premium positioning for serious competitive anglers.

Specialized applications were also represented in the testing, with models like the Okuma Dead Eye showcasing design innovations specifically for jigging applications. Meanwhile, the Berkley Cherrywood provided a well-rounded option for anglers seeking quality construction at an affordable price point.

"The assortment of rods available today means anglers have access to tools that can enhance their fishing experience dramatically," Reed observed, noting how technological advances and increased specialization have created options for virtually every fishing style and budget.

The comprehensive evaluation process considered multiple factors beyond basic performance, including construction quality, warranty coverage, versatility across different walleye techniques, and long-term durability. Each rod was tested in various conditions and scenarios that walleye anglers commonly encounter, from precise presentations around structure to handling larger fish in open water.

The choice of rod plays an increasingly crucial role in angling success, particularly for walleye fishing where subtle bite detection and precise lure presentation often determine results. Modern rod designs incorporate advanced materials and tapered actions that enhance sensitivity while maintaining the backbone necessary for hook sets and fish control.

As the walleye fishing scene continues to evolve, having appropriate equipment becomes essential for maximizing success on the water.
